Madurai, one of Tamil Nadu's most revered temple cities, is a spiritual haven that captures the essence of ancient Indian culture and traditions. The Meenakshi Amman Temple, a true marvel of Dravidian architecture, stands as the city's iconic pilgrimage site, attracting countless devotees, families, and cultural travelers from across the globe. Dedicated to Goddess Meenakshi and her consort Lord Sundareswarar (Shiva), the temple boasts a rich historical backdrop that dates back over 2,500 years, underlining its significance in the devotion and heritage of Hindu culture. The architectural grandeur of the temple is evident in its intricately carved gopurams (towering gateways), stunning sculptures, and vast temple corridors, each telling tales of Mythology and history. The Meenakshi Amman Temple, deeply interwoven with the fabric of Madurai, serves not only as a spiritual epicenter but also as a historical marvel boasting intricate gopurams and detailed sculptures that narrate tales of ancient lore. Pilgrims visiting this temple will find themselves mesmerized by the grandeur of the Thousand Pillar Hall and the serene beauty of the Golden Lotus Pond, or Potramarai Kulam, which acts as a focal point for many rituals. As you traverse through the temple corridors and mandapams, you will get an immersive experience tied to age-old customs, particularly during the Meenakshi Thirukalyanam festival when the temple comes alive with vibrancy and devotion.

The ideal time to visit Madurai is between October and March when the weather is pleasant. The temple typically opens at 5 AM and remains accessible until 12:30 PM, then again from 4 PM to 10 PM, allowing ample time to plan your sacred visit. With easy connectivity via Madurai Airport and Madurai Railway Station, private transportation options ensure a hassle-free journey.
